Heim > Artikel > Web-Frontend > Wie automatisiere ich Aufgaben alle 5 Sekunden mit setInterval() von jQuery?
Effiziente Funktionsausführung in jQuery: Aufgaben alle 5 Sekunden automatisieren
Im Bereich der Webentwicklung fallen häufig Aufgaben wie die Automatisierung von Bild-Diashows an. Eine häufige Frage unter jQuery-Enthusiasten ist, wie diese Funktionalität effizient erreicht werden kann.
Um dieser Herausforderung zu begegnen, besteht ein einfacher, aber effektiver Ansatz darin, die integrierte setInterval()-Funktion von jQuery zu verwenden. Diese Funktion ermöglicht die Ausführung einer bestimmten Funktion in regelmäßigen Abständen.
Bedenken Sie den folgenden jQuery-Code:
<code class="javascript">function myFunction() { // Your function to be executed } setInterval(myFunction, 5000);</code>
Dieser Code richtet im Wesentlichen einen Timer ein, der alle 5 Sekunden die Funktion myFunction auslöst.
Alternativ, wenn Sie lieber mit reinem JavaScript arbeiten möchten, können Sie die Funktion setInterval() wie folgt verwenden:
<code class="javascript">var intervalId = window.setInterval(function() { // Your function to be executed }, 5000);</code>
Um die Schleife zu stoppen, können Sie einfach clearInterval(intervalId) aufrufen. .
Mit diesem Ansatz können Sie Aufgaben effektiv automatisieren und die Funktionsausführung in bestimmten Zeitintervallen in Ihren jQuery-Anwendungen planen.
Das obige ist der detaillierte Inhalt vonWie automatisiere ich Aufgaben alle 5 Sekunden mit setInterval() von jQuery?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!